Protecting The Building Envelope
Your roof is the capstone of the building envelope, the system that keeps weather out and conditioned air in. When that barrier fails, moisture reaches framing, drywall, and flooring, which multiplies repair costs. Professional crews use correct flashing details, quality underlayment, and proper fastener patterns to keep water moving away from vulnerable areas. That technical accuracy lowers the likelihood of leaks, mold, and structural damage, protecting the rest of the house from avoidable expenses.

Energy And Comfort Gains
Heat that builds in the attic forces HVAC equipment to run longer, and cold spots can do the same in winter. A professional project pairs the roof with intake and ridge ventilation, and it verifies insulation protection around eaves and penetrations. The result is steadier attic temperatures and fewer losses through the ceiling plane. Over time, that helps lower utility bills, reduces wear on equipment, and improves day-to-day comfort in living spaces.

Smart Timing And Scope Choices
Waiting until a roof fails usually costs more than replacing it on a planned timeline. Proactive replacement lets you bundle deck repairs, ventilation upgrades, and accessory replacements while the surface is open. Addressing these items together prevents rework and reduces future labor. The right timing also means you can select materials without pressure, compare profiles that match the home, and schedule the project in a season that fits your calendar.
